The automotive world is abuzz with speculation surrounding a thinly veiled Mercedes-AMG CLE-Class, spotted braving the icy embrace of Swedish winter testing. The visual cues are unmistakable to anyone who has followed the AMG lineage: a dramatically sculpted aerodynamic package, hinting at intentions far beyond mere aesthetics. A prominent rear wing, while not the overtly dramatic swan-neck design seen on track-focused specials, suggests a serious focus on downforce and stability at extreme velocities. More telling, perhaps, is the aggressive front fascia. The expansive, gaping grille openings are not for show; they are vital arteries, designed to feed an insatiable appetite for airflow, suggesting a powerplant of considerable thermal demands.

The “Mythos” Enigma: Rarity Meets Raw Power
Adding another layer of intrigue, this high-performance CLE-Class is confirmed to be a part of Mercedes-Benz’s ultra-exclusive “Mythos” series. This isn’t a mass-produced performance variant; it’s a limited-run masterpiece, designed for the most discerning collectors and driving aficionados. As the second offering from this bespoke program, following the conceptually stunning Mercedes-AMG PureSpeed, this new CLE-Class Mythos is poised to be an exceedingly rare specimen. Its exclusivity will undoubtedly translate into a significant premium, a price point that reflects not just the engineering prowess but also the bespoke craftsmanship and limited availability. The Engine Question: V-8 Rumors and Six-Cylinder Potential
The burning question, of course, revolves around the heart of this beast. The current Mercedes-AMG CLE53 already boasts a formidable 443-horsepower turbocharged inline-six. This powerplant is a marvel of engineering, delivering instant torque and a sonorous exhaust note. However, the aggressive styling of this Mythos variant strongly implies a significant leap in power and performance.
The most persistent rumor, and perhaps the most exciting prospect, is the potential integration of Mercedes-AMG’s legendary twin-turbocharged 4.0-liter V-8 engine. This engine has been the cornerstone of AMG’s most iconic models for years, renowned for its brutal acceleration, intoxicating torque curve, and distinctive AMG growl. Slotting this V-8 into the CLE-Class platform would undoubtedly create a formidable competitor in the high-performance coupe segment.
